What companies run services between Hackney Wick, England and Battersea, England?
Stagecoach London operates a bus from St Mary Of Eton Church to Westminster Cathedral / Victoria Station every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£3 and the journey takes 1h 15m. National Express also services this route 5 times a week. Alternatively, London Overground operates a train from Hackney Wick to Clapham Junction every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£3–7 and the journey takes 59 min.
